What do delivery fees typically look like for bulk materials in Butte des Morts and West Wisconsin?

Delivery fees vary by distance, truck type, site access, and material. Many local orders qualify for free delivery, but remote or difficult-access jobs can incur a modest fee (commonly in the low two- or three-digit range). Hello Gravel shows upfront pricing at checkout so you can see any delivery charges before you confirm your order.

Which material characteristics perform best through Wisconsin freeze-thaw cycles and heavy snow?

Materials that drain well and lock together tend to hold up best during freeze-thaw cycles. For many projects, a layered approach with a well-compacted base and a free-draining top layer helps reduce frost heave and rutting. Consider the local climate and drainage when choosing from gravel, sand, dirt, stone and ask our team for options suited to West Wisconsin conditions.

Are permits, weight limits, or HOA rules likely to affect a bulk material delivery in Butte des Morts?

They can. Local municipalities and counties may have road weight limits, rules about parking a dump truck for off-loading, or permits required for large street-side drops, and HOAs may restrict visible stockpiles or material types. Check with Butte des Morts city or county public works and your HOA before delivery, and provide any permit details at checkout so your supplier can plan accordingly.

How do Butte des Morts soil type and drainage influence the best surface materials for driveways and yards?

Soils with poor drainage or high clay content are more prone to settling and freeze-thaw damage, so they usually need a more permeable base and improved drainage before surfacing. Choosing materials that promote drainage and using geotextile separators or a thicker compacted base can extend life. Think about drainage first when selecting from gravel, sand, dirt, stone so you get a material that matches local soil conditions.

What are quick quantity estimates for driveways, patios, and pathways?

Estimate materials in cubic yards rather than tons because densities vary by product. As a rule of thumb, one cubic yard covers about 108 sq ft at a 3-inch depth or about 81 sq ft at a 4-inch depth. For most residential driveways expect a 4-6 inch surface layer plus a deeper compacted base; use our online calculator for precise estimates by area and desired depth.

Which materials are most cost-effective for high-traffic residential driveways in the West Wisconsin region?

Cost-effective choices balance durability, drainage, and maintenance needs. A compacted base topped with a well-draining surface material tends to offer the best lifecycle value for driveways. Consider materials that compact well and resist displacement, and factor in periodic maintenance like grading and adding material over time when comparing costs.

Do suppliers in rural Butte des Morts offer off-loading services or smaller trucks for tight-access properties?

Many local suppliers and haulers can accommodate tight sites by using smaller trucks, off-loading at the street, or arranging special equipment, but availability varies by supplier and schedule. Note access limitations in your order notes and discuss them with our team so we can match you with a supplier that can meet your needs. Drivers may be able to provide tailgate spreading at their discretion, but this is not guaranteed.

How does seasonal timing (spring thaw, fall freeze) affect installation quality and cost in Butte des Morts?

Spring thaw can leave soil soft and prone to rutting, while frozen ground in winter makes compaction and grading difficult, so installation quality can suffer outside of the warmer months. Contractors often prefer late spring through early fall for major installs; off-season work can cost more due to limited availability and extra steps needed to manage ground conditions. Plan projects with local seasonality in mind to reduce rework and added expense.

What maintenance should I expect and what are typical lifecycle costs for common landscape and driveway materials in Wisconsin climates?

Routine maintenance typically includes occasional regrading, adding fresh material every few years, weed control, and cleaning drainage features. Lifecycle costs depend on the material, traffic levels, and how well the base was prepared; materials installed over a good base usually require less frequent repairs. Budget for periodic topping and seasonal maintenance to keep surfaces performing through Wisconsin winters.
